Honestly, I was nervous about this too when I cancelled. The wording on some menus can feel a bit ominous, like you're undoing everything. But it's designed that way to make you second-guess leaving. Your permanent library is completely separate from the subscription service. Think of KU as a revolving door of borrows—when you stop paying, those borrowed books return to the 'store.' Anything you spent actual money on, even if it was just $2.99 on a daily deal, is yours.

A minor tangent, but this is why I always 'buy' the free classic novels even though they're on KU. It locks them into my permanent collection at zero cost. After I cancelled, my library was suddenly a lot thinner visually because all the KU covers were gone, but scrolling down confirmed my owned titles were intact. The system works; they just don't advertise that fact clearly.

It's a common worry, but you won't lose your purchased books. The membership and your owned content are on different ledgers. Cancel from the 'Manage Your Membership' page, not by deleting payment methods. Your library is cloud-based, so as long as you can log into your Amazon account, you can redownload your books to any device. The only loss is access to the KU catalogue itself.

Cancelling Kindle Unlimited but keeping your purchased library is straightforward, though Amazon's interface doesn't always make it obvious. You navigate to 'Your Memberships & Subscriptions' through your account settings. The trick is ensuring you're only cancelling the recurring KU payment, not closing your Amazon account itself. Your bought books and any Kindle freebies you've 'purchased' for $0.00 are tied to your main Amazon account, not the subscription. They live in the 'Content and Devices' section.

I let my subscription lapse last year after a binge-reading phase. All the books I'd actually bought were still there in my library, no issue. The only ones that vanished were the titles I was currently borrowing through KU, which I expected. Just double-check before confirming the cancellation that the page specifies it's for 'Kindle Unlimited' and not something broader. The books you own are safe; they're essentially digital licenses attached to your login.

What happens after I cancel kindle membership?

5 答案2025-07-12 02:27:41
I’ve canceled my membership a couple of times, and here’s what happens. Your access to Kindle Unlimited books stops immediately, and any borrowed titles disappear from your library. However, books you’ve purchased outright stay with you forever—they’re yours to keep. You’ll still be able to read those anytime, even without the membership. One thing to note is that Amazon doesn’t prorate refunds, so if you cancel mid-cycle, you won’t get money back for unused days. But you do keep the full benefits until the billing period ends. Also, if you’ve marked notes or highlights in borrowed books, those will vanish unless you buy the book later. If you think you might resubscribe, it’s worth keeping a list of titles you enjoyed so you can easily find them again. The process is straightforward, and you can always rejoin later if you miss the endless library.

How do I cancel my Amazon Kindle membership?

4 答案2026-03-27 02:38:34
Canceling an Amazon Kindle membership can feel like navigating a maze if you're not familiar with the process, but it's actually pretty straightforward once you know where to look. I had to do this recently when I realized I wasn't using the service enough to justify the cost. First, you'll need to log into your Amazon account on a browser—the mobile app doesn't give you full access to all the settings. From there, hover over 'Account & Lists' and click 'Memberships & Subscriptions.' You'll see your Kindle Unlimited or Prime Reading listed there, and next to it, a button to cancel. Amazon will try to offer you discounts to stay, but if you're set on leaving, just confirm the cancellation. One thing to note is the timing. If you cancel mid-cycle, you'll still have access until the end of the billing period, which is fair. I also made sure to download any books I wanted to keep permanently before canceling, since borrowed titles disappear once your subscription ends. It took me less than five minutes, and I got an email confirmation right away. Now I just borrow books from my local library instead—way cheaper!
